大学电脑编程学什么软件

fiy 其他 2

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    大学电脑编程主要学习以下几类软件:

    1. 编程语言:大学电脑编程的基础是学习一种或多种编程语言,如Java、C++、Python等。不同的编程语言有不同的编程思想和特点,学习编程语言可以让学生熟悉基本的程序设计和编写技巧。

    2. 开发工具:学习编程需要使用一些专门的开发工具,如集成开发环境(IDE)和代码编辑器。常见的开发工具有Eclipse、Visual Studio、PyCharm等。这些工具提供方便的代码编辑、调试、编译和运行环境,使学生能够更高效地编写和测试代码。

    3. 数据库管理系统:在实际开发中,经常需要使用数据库来存储和管理数据。学生需要学习一些数据库管理系统,如MySQL、Oracle、SQL Server等。通过学习数据库管理系统,学生可以了解数据的组织和存储方式,以及使用SQL语言进行数据库操作的基本技巧。

    4. 操作系统:学生还需要学习一些操作系统的基础知识,如Linux、Windows等。操作系统是计算机系统的核心组成部分,对于编程涉及到的并发、进程管理、文件系统等方面有重要的影响。

    5. Web开发技术:如今互联网发展迅速,Web开发成为了一个非常重要的领域。学生需要学习一些Web开发技术,如HTML、CSS、JavaScript、PHP等。通过学习这些技术,学生可以学会设计和开发网页,实现丰富的用户交互和数据处理功能。

    总之,大学电脑编程学习的软件主要包括编程语言、开发工具、数据库管理系统、操作系统和Web开发技术等。这些软件将为学生打下坚实的编程基础,为他们今后的编程工作和研究提供良好的支持。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在大学电脑编程课程中,学生将学习多种软件,这些软件可以帮助他们开发和编程不同类型的应用程序。以下是大学电脑编程课程中常见的软件:

    1. 编程语言软件:在编程课程中,学生通常会接触多种编程语言,如C++、Java、Python等。这些软件提供了编写和运行代码的平台,学生可以学习如何使用这些语言来创建各种应用程序。

    2. 集成开发环境(IDE):IDE是一种软件,用于编写、编译和调试代码。它提供了一个集成的开发环境,包括代码编辑器、调试工具、编译器等。常见的IDE有Eclipse、Visual Studio、PyCharm等。

    3. 数据库管理系统(DBMS):数据库管理系统是一种用于存储、管理和检索数据的软件。在大学编程课程中,学生将学习使用DBMS来设计和创建数据库,并使用SQL(结构化查询语言)来查询和操作数据。常见的DBMS软件有MySQL、Oracle、Microsoft SQL Server等。

    4. 版本控制软件:版本控制软件用于跟踪和管理代码的变更。它可以记录代码的修改历史,并允许多个开发人员同时协作开发。常见的版本控制软件有Git、SVN等。

    5. 软件开发工具包(SDK):软件开发工具包是一套提供开发应用程序所需工具和库的软件。它可以帮助开发人员快速创建和部署应用程序。不同的平台和技术将有不同的SDK,如Android SDK用于Android应用程序开发,iOS SDK用于iOS应用程序开发等。

    除了上述软件,大学电脑编程课程还可能涉及其他软件,如网页开发工具、图形设计软件、模拟器等,这些工具都有助于学生实践和运用所学的编程知识。总的来说,大学电脑编程课程中的软件多样且不断更新,以适应不同的编程需求和技术趋势。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    大学电脑编程学习涉及到多种软件和工具,以下是一些主要的软件和工具:

    1. 集成开发环境(IDE):IDE是一种综合的开发软件,可以提供代码编辑、编译、调试、版本控制等功能。一些常见的IDE有:Eclipse、IntelliJ IDEA、Visual Studio、Xcode等。不同的编程语言和平台有不同的IDE可供选择。

    2. 文本编辑器:一些编程语言的开发者喜欢使用轻量级的文本编辑器来编写代码,例如Sublime Text、Atom、Visual Studio Code等。这些编辑器具有代码高亮、自动补全等功能。

    3. 版本控制系统:版本控制系统可以帮助开发者管理和追踪代码的变化。最常用的版本控制系统是Git,还有一些其他选择,如SVN和Mercurial。

    4. 虚拟机和容器:通过虚拟机和容器,可以在一台物理计算机上模拟多个独立的计算环境。常见的虚拟机软件有VirtualBox、VMware,常见的容器软件有Docker。

    5. 数据库管理系统:学习数据库编程时,需要使用数据库管理系统来创建、管理和查询数据库。一些常见的数据库管理系统有MySQL、Oracle、SQL Server、PostgreSQL等。

    6. 编译器和解释器:编译器将源代码转换为可执行文件,解释器逐行执行源代码。不同的编程语言通常有自己的编译器或解释器,例如C语言使用gcc编译器,Python使用CPython解释器。

    7. 调试器:调试器用于帮助开发者定位和解决程序中的错误。常用的调试工具有GDB(C/C++)、pdb(Python)、LLDB(iOS开发)等。

    8. 动态分析工具:动态分析工具用于检测和优化代码性能。例如,Profiling工具可以分析程序的运行时间和内存占用情况,优化工具可以帮助改进程序的性能。

    以上是一些大学电脑编程学习中常用的软件和工具,具体使用哪些软件和工具取决于学习的编程语言、开发平台和个人偏好。此外,新的软件和工具不断出现,学习者还应保持对新技术的学习和探索。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部